Mobile App Team Performance Dashboard
To view a consolidated profile card for each of my team members on the mobile app that includes their basic details, HR discipline metrics, and real-time sales performance,
So that I can easily track their daily, monthly, and yearly productivity, monitor their field activities (beats), and identify any attendance issues at a glance.
1. UI & Navigation:
- The screen must be titled "Team Performance" with a red header.
- The header must include a "Back" arrow to return to the previous screen and a "Home" icon to navigate to the main dashboard.
- The screen should display a vertically scrollable list of individual employee cards.
2. Employee Profile Card (Header Section):
- Each employee card must display the following basic information clearly:
- Employee Name and Region/Code (e.g., Emp Sales 2 60 (RJ)).
- Contact details: Email Address (clickable to launch email client) and Phone Number (clickable to launch dialer).
- Department (e.g., Dept: Sales).
- Assigned routes/areas listed as "Beats" (e.g., Beat 001, Mansarovar).
3. HR Discipline Accordion (Collapsible/Expandable):
- The card must feature an expandable section titled "HR Discipline" accompanied by a user icon.
- When expanded, it must display the following attendance metrics:
- Check In Missed: (Must display a numerical count, not "null").
- Check Out Missed: (Must display a numerical count).
- Leave Applied: (Must display a numerical count of leaves taken/applied).
4. Check Performance Accordion (Collapsible/Expandable):
- The card must feature an expandable section titled "Check Performance" accompanied by a lightning bolt icon.
- When expanded, it must display key sales and operational metrics broken down by timeframes (Today / MTD - Month to Date / YTD - Year to Date or LTD - Life to Date):
- Revenue: Displayed in a specific currency format (e.g., Lakhs - "L").
- Sale Order: Count of orders generated.
- My Sale Visit: Count of field visits completed.
- Retailer: Count of retailers onboarded or visited.
5. Partner Performance Navigation:
- At the bottom of each employee card, there must be a primary blue button labeled "Partner Performance".
- Tapping this button must navigate the user to a detailed view of that specific employee's performance metrics regarding their assigned partners or distributors.
